摘要

The effects of norepinephrine and related molecules on the generation ofantitumor cytotoxic activity were determined. Cytotoxic activity was generated by coculture of normal spleen lymphocytes from BALB/c mice with syngeneic MOPC-315 plasmacytoma cells and was assayed by the Cr release assay. At concentrations of 100 micrograms, the catecholamines norepinephrine, epinephrine, isoproterenol and dopamine inhibited the development of cytotoxic activity by 50-90%. However, at concentrations of 0.1 to 1 micrograms norepinephrine but not the other catecholamines enhanced the generation of cytotoxicity.
